New rates for recreation use approved by High River Town Council will affect the price of taking part in aqua fitness at the Bob Snodgrass Recreation Complex.

Recreation Administration and Programming Supervisor Tracy Morgan says the increase will be applied the next time you purchase a pass.

"The rate will be an extra fifty cents per session for the aqua fitness class," said Tracy Morgan. "That is to help cover the cost of the aqua fitness instructor."

For an annual pass, which has a value equivalent to 68 days of use but is useable for an entire year, the new aqua fitness charge adds $34 for all users, regardless of their age.

If someone has already purchased a pass they don't have to pay the increase until the next pass.
